Ergonomic Evaluation of Manual Winnower: a Practical Method of Estimating an Individual's Maximum Energy Expenditure Rate

This Book serves as a useful knowledge in the field of Agricultural Technology and Engineering. A Hand operated winnower was developed for ergonomic evaluation. The winnower was ergonomically evaluated using 6 subjects. Two workers are required for the operation of this winnower, one for cranking the blower and other for feeding the threshed material and collection of grain. The mean heart rate, Oxygen consumption rate, and Energy expenditure rate of the workers and their output were measured to evaluate the winnower. The equipment developed was found to be suitable for operation by male as well as women workers as the heart rate, work pulse value and energy expenditure rate are within the acceptable limits.
